Touring cycling around Cinco Villas, a region in Aragon, Spain, features diverse landscapes from expansive plains to pre-Pyrenean mountains. The northern part includes the Sierra de Santo Domingo, a Natural Protected Area with pine and oak forests and deep valleys. The terrain transitions to plains in the south, including unique geological formations like the Aguarales de Valpalmas. This varied geography provides a wide array of routes suitable for different cycling preferences.

Yéquera Castle, also known as Yecra Castle or Lacorvilla Castle, is located in the uninhabited medieval village of Yéquera. Its origins date back to a 10th-century Muslim fortification. In 1093, the Aragonese king Sancho Ramírez ordered the construction of a fortification to secure control of the newly conquered lands.

Obano Castle is an Aragonese fortification built in the second half of the 11th century, during the reign of Sancho Ramírez. It is located in the municipality of Luna, in the Cinco Villas region. This Romanesque-style castle was built to guard the communication routes between Huesca and Ejea de los Caballeros. The castle is located near the Arba de Biel River and is known for its defensive tower, which rises to approximately 16 meters in height. Throughout its history, the castle has belonged to the Knights Templar and the Monastery of San Juan de la Peña.

The Aguarales de Valdemilaz, also known as Aguarales de Valpalmas, are a stunning geological landscape located near the town of Valpalmas, in the Cinco Villas region, province of Zaragoza. This site is famous for its unique rock formations, created by water and wind erosion over millions of years. These formations, known as fairy chimneys, are similar to those seen in the Göreme Valley in Cappadocia, Türkiye.

The region boasts incredibly diverse landscapes, from the expansive plains in the south to the pre-Pyrenean mountains of the Sierra de Santo Domingo in the north. You'll cycle through lush pine and oak forests, deep valleys, and unique geological formations like the Aguarales de Valpalmas. The changing colors of the flora throughout the year add to the scenic beauty.

Cinco Villas is rich in history. Many routes pass by or near medieval castles, Romanesque churches, and ancient Roman ruins. For example, the Roman site of Los Banales y Biota — circular from Sádaba Castle takes you through historical landscapes. You can also explore towns like Sos del Rey Católico, Sádaba Castle, and Uncastillo Historic Center, which offer well-preserved medieval architecture.

The best time for touring cycling in Cinco Villas is generally during the spring (April-May) and autumn (September-October). During these seasons, the weather is typically mild and pleasant, making for comfortable riding conditions. The varied flora also offers beautiful changing colors, especially in autumn.
